Thatching is the procedure of removing the layer of dead grass, roots, and organic particles that collects in between the soil and living turf, which can restrain water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can lead to shallow root systems, increased pest problems, and uneven growth. Strategies for thatching include manual raking or using specialized dethatching devices that raises and gets rid of the layer without destructive healthy turf The procedure is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y recovery and development. Regular thatching ensures much better soil-to-grass contact, boosts nutrient uptake, and maintains a lavish, resistant lawn. Incorporating thatching into lawn care routines improves both the appearance and long-lasting health of turf.
